The year 1992 marked a significant milestone for Dolce & Gabbana, witnessing the launch of their eponymous fragrance, simply titled "Dolce & Gabbana." This inaugural scent laid the foundation for the brand's future olfactory endeavors, establishing a signature style that blended Sicilian sun-drenched notes with a sophisticated, almost opulent, undercurrent. This original Dolce & Gabbana perfume, with its blend of floral, fruity, and spicy notes, arguably possessed a certain intoxicating quality – a "poison" in the sense of being irresistibly addictive and captivating. Its success paved the way for a diverse range of fragrances, each reflecting different facets of the Dolce & Gabbana persona.
